In a world where intellectual elitism often dictates the narrative of knowledge and innovation, artificial intelligence emerges as a transformative force. Genius, traditionally viewed as an exclusive trait possessed by a select few, is being redefined. AI has the potential to ignite and amplify moments of insight that can lead to groundbreaking ideas and solutions.
The democratization of knowledge through AI tools allows individuals from diverse backgrounds to tap into their creative potential. By providing access to vast amounts of information and advanced analytical capabilities, AI can help bridge the gap between experts and novices. This shift challenges the long-standing notion that intellectual prowess is reserved for an elite class.
Moreover, AI's ability to analyze patterns and generate new ideas can serve as a catalyst for collaboration, fostering an environment where shared insights lead to collective genius. As we embrace this technological evolution, the barriers to intellectual achievement may begin to dissolve, paving the way for a more inclusive and innovative future.
